HANOVER TWP. – Township police reported the following:
• Elizabeth Pryce, of Mark Drive, reported Wednesday a can of beans was dumped on her vehicle.
• Police said J.L. Turner on Keith Street reported Wednesday approximately 60 feet of copper tubing was stolen from a storage trailer that was forced open.
• Household garbage was discovered dumped along Great Valley Boulevard, owned by the Wilkes-Barre Chamber of Commerce, on Wednesday.
• A woman was recorded on surveillance video stealing an ice cream bar inside EZ Express on the Sans Souci Parkway on Wednesday.
WILKES-BARRE – City police reported the following:
• Joseph Pascavage, of Kingston, was charged with burglary, criminal mischief, criminal trespass and theft after he allegedly kicked in a basement window at 424 S. Franklin St. and stole items on Monday.
• Lamar Johnson, 32, of Parkview Circle, was arraigned Wednesday in Wilkes-Barre Central Court on charges of simple assault and harassment after Jessica Griffiths alleged he assaulted her outside Kasper's Watering Hole tavern on Scott Street on Dec. 30.
Johnson was jailed at the Luzerne County Correctional Facility for lack of $2,500 bail.
A preliminary hearing is scheduled on March 29.
